Ballymac' complete 40 in-a-row!
Waterford's Michelle Ryan shoots on goal

Ballymacarbry’s remarkable dominance of the Waterford ladies football scene continued yesterday when they defeated Comeragh Rangers 4-5 to 0-7 to be crowned senior champions for a 40th successive year.

With former Waterford and Westmeath hurling manager Michael Ryan back at the helm since last year and his daughter Michelle – who’s currently featuring on TG4’s ‘Underdogs’ programme – helping herself to 2-2, Ballymac came from a point down at half-time to keep their incredible winning run going.

Karen McGrath and Bríd McMaugh scored the other goals for the winners, who are unbeaten in county finals since 1982.
